Marcy Engel

AB '80 Econ
Chief Operating Officer and General Counsel
Eton Park Capital Management, L.P.

Marcy Engel is the Chief Operating Officer and General Counsel of Eton Park Capital Management, L.P., a global alternatives investment firm, which she joined as a partner in 2005.  In this role, she is responsible for all of the non-investment aspects of Eton Park’s business including Investor Relations, Technology, Operations, Finance, Treasury, Risk, Legal and Compliance, and Human Resources and Facilities. She was a member of the firm’s Management Committee, as well as other key committees including the Commitment Committee, Business Practices Committee and Valuation Committee.  In addition, she focuses on strategy and other firm wide matters.  
                
Prior to joining Eton Park, Ms. Engel worked for Citigroup and its predecessor firms, Salomon Smith Barney and Salomon Brothers, Inc., most recently as Head of Planning and Operating Risk for its Fixed Income Division.  Prior to that, Ms. Engel served as General Counsel of Salomon Smith Barney and Managing Deputy General Counsel of Citigroup’s Global Corporate and Investment Bank, where she was also a member of its Management Committee, Risk Committee, New Product Approval Committee and Business Practices Committee.  She began her career as a litigation associate at Sullivan & Cromwell.
 
Ms. Engel is a member of the Dean’s Advisory Committee of the College of Literature, Science and the Arts at the University of Michigan and of the Board of Overseers of the University of Pennsylvania Law School. She is a member of the Board of Directors of Och-Ziff Capital Management Group, LLC and serves as the Chair of the Nominating, Corporate Governance and Conflicts Committee, as well as a member of its Audit Committee, Compensation Committee and Corporate Responsibility and Compliance Committee. Ms. Engel holds a AB from the University of Michigan and a JD from the University of Pennsylvania Law School.
 
Ms. Engel has significant experience in the financial services sector, including serving as a senior executive with an alternative investment firm, investment bank and bank. She has in-depth knowledge experience in enterprise risk management and controls, financial services regulation and products, legal and compliance, and an overall strong background in management of teams and projects.
